Output 3ebecba0bcfb7fcf058d78d2281d448f2fb0df9496844d6d7836c2907776ab65:26

value
429783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abce2949c011ca3486a19f9adbd8eef38e043927 OP_EQUAL
address
3HMSSgcJCqW9HHz2rqPthGadZR5cZN6xcx
transaction
3ebecba0bcfb7fcf058d78d2281d448f2fb0df9496844d6d7836c2907776ab65
spent
true